The Magic of Naturally Gentle Fibers
So, what makes bamboo so special? First, the fibers are round and smooth, which means there's less friction against your baby's skin. This smooth texture is a key reason why organic bamboo baby clothing feels so luxuriously soft, often compared to silk or cashmere. Second, bamboo is naturally hypoallergenic and antimicrobial. This helps inhibit the growth of bacteria and odor, which is a big plus for keeping your baby's skin calm and reducing potential irritants. Superior Breathability and Temperature Control
Another amazing feature is its breathability. Bamboo fabric is highly porous, allowing for excellent air circulation. This helps wick moisture away from the skin, keeping your baby dry and comfortable. It's a natural temperature regulator, too—cool in summer and warm in winter. This makes bamboo viscose baby outfits perfect for all seasons and can be especially comforting for babies who tend to overheat or sweat.

Key Features to Look For
When shopping for soft bamboo baby wear, keep an eye on a few details. Look for certifications like Oeko-Tex Standard 100, which guarantees the fabric is free from harmful substances. I also recommend checking the blend; 100% bamboo viscose is great, but sometimes a small percentage of spandex is added for stretch, which is perfectly fine. The seams should be flat and soft (often called flatlock seams) to prevent chafing. And don't forget about the fit—gentle baby clothing should be snug but not restrictive, allowing for plenty of wiggles and growth!
Caring for Your Bamboo Garments
To keep those hypoallergenic infant garments in perfect, soft condition, a little gentle care goes a long way. We suggest washing them in cool water on a gentle cycle with a mild, fragrance-free detergent. Avoid fabric softeners and bleach, as they can break down the natural fibers. Tumble drying on low heat is okay, but air-drying is the gentlest option and helps preserve the fabric's integrity for longer. Following these simple steps will keep your baby's wardrobe feeling like new.
Common Myths and Truths About Bamboo Babywear
You might hear different things about bamboo clothing, so let's clear up a couple of common points. One myth is that all bamboo fabric is stiff or scratchy. In truth, high-quality bamboo viscose is famously soft right out of the package and gets even softer with each wash. Another question is about sustainability. While bamboo is a fast-growing, renewable resource, the manufacturing process to create viscose can vary. For the most eco-friendly choice, look for brands that use a closed-loop process, which recycles water and solvents. The goal is to find sensitive skin-friendly baby clothes that are good for your baby and the planet.
